LSU football holds 23 commitments in the 2024 recruiting class with Brian Kelly and his staff looking to make a splash before the Early Signing Period in December.
The Tigers have hosted elite-level talent over the last six weeks in both the 2024 and 2025 cycles, but with the finish line in sight in the current class, this program is turning up the heat for a few committed targets.

Trouble in College Station?
LSU took a stride in the right direction last weekend after bringing in a trio of Texas A&M commitments to town. LSU hosted five-star ATH Terry Bussey, four-star wide receiver Dre’lon Miller and four-star defensive lineman Gabriel Reliford for visits.
Shortly after the visit, one domino fell when Miller announced he would be reopening his recruitment. The job isn’t finished, but with the four-star wideout opening things back up off of a visit to Baton Rouge, the Bayou Bengals are trending.
The latest on the current and former Texas A&M commits:
Dre'lon Miller... The four-star wide receiver backed off of his commitment to Texas A&M on Tuesday following a visit to Baton Rouge last weekend. Miller, who has several potential suitors, has been wined and dined by LSU on several occasions with the Tigers trending for the electrifying wideout. The star receiver dominated in his junior campaign. He tallied 1,399 yards of total offense, 21 touchdown catches, 361 yards rushing while also impacting the game on special teams. Now, he’s back on the market with LSU surging for his services. The Tigers lost a commitment from three-star wide receiver Joseph Stone this week as the Bayou Bengals shift focus to Miller to fill the void. A name to keep tabs on sooner rather than later.
Terry Bussey... Bussey returned to Baton Rouge once again last weekend after taking an official to LSU when the Tigers faced off against Arkansas in September. Shortly after his visit, he revealed his commitment to Jimbo Fisher and Texas A&M. Now, it’s clear there’s mutual interest between LSU and Bussey after a return trip to Death Valley, but he remains locked in with the Aggies. It'll be a challenge to flip Bussey from the Aggies, but there have been rumblings of uncertainty surrounding his pledge. With mutual interest between both parties (LSU and Bussey’s camp), he remains a name to monitor as Texas A&M’s struggles continue.
Gabriel Reliford... The Louisiana native made the trip down to Baton Rouge for a second game day experience when he arrived last weekend. Reliford has been pledged to Texas A&M for a while but it hasn’t stopped Kelly and Co. from pushing for his services. He’s visited campus on several occasions as this staff continues a full-court press to flip the current Aggie pledge. Look for Reliford to return before the season ends as the LSU staff locks in on adding another defensive lineman to the 2024 class.
Must-Get: Bernard Causey
The Ole Miss commitment is a player whose stock is rising at a rapid rate and LSU has taken notice after dishing out an offer weeks ago. Causey, a Louisiana native, is at the top of LSU's "wish list" when it comes to adding another cornerback to the 2024 class with this area certainly being a position of need.
The Tigers lost a commitment from four-star cornerback Ondre Evans on Wednesday. Now, it’s full steam ahead to reel in Causey from the Lane Kiffin's Rebels.
Experts within the industry believe LSU ultimately wins out here for Causey's services, and with Evans now out of the picture in the current cycle, it's imperative this program locks down the in-state defensive back.
The 6-foot, 160-pounder out of New Orleans is a "must-get" for the Tigers as they look to revamp the cornerback room moving forward. Look for this program to ramp up his recruitment in a big way as they look for another cornerback or two in the 2024 cycle.
